The Mar Menor

The Mar Menor, just 20 minutes drive from our penthouses, is a salty lagoon separated from the Mediterranean Sea by a 20km sand bar.  With a coastal length of 70km and its warm, shallow waters, the Mar Menor boasts glorious beaches and some of the best water sports facilities in the world.  The gently shelving beaches and maximum depth of 7m (22 feet) make the Mar Menor ideal for swimmers, as well as a variety of water sports.
